Welcome to on-call for the Glimmerpane design system! Our snapshot tests live in the `snapcheck` suite and run on every merge to main. If a UI component changes visually, the diff bot flags it — usually it's an intentional tweak, so just approve the new baseline. If it's 2am and snapshots are failing across the board, it's almost always a font-loading race, not your problem. To unlock the baseline store and re-approve snapshots in bulk, use the recovery passphrase below.

recovery phrase for tahag-taguf: wenix-caswyn

Ticket: Proctoring queue vault sealed — Examtrack

For the weekly eng sync: the secrets vault backing the Examtrack exam-proctoring queue sealed itself after Friday's node restart. Queue workers can't fetch credentials, so proctoring sessions are draining to the fallback pool. Capacity there is fine through midweek, but we should unseal before Thursday's exam window. Marek has the unseal script ready; it only needs the recovery passphrase, which is noted below for the on-call lead.

unlock words, hahip-yagef: zorok-novmir-zorix-silax

## Deploying the Gatewick Proctor Queue

Deploys are pretty painless: push to main, wait for the pipeline, then watch the queue drain dashboard for five minutes. If candidates pile up mid-exam, roll back first and ask questions later — the queue replays safely. Everything the workers care about lives in one config block, shown here for reference.

settings of bafof-yagef:
JOROX_PIN=8740
JOROX_TENANT=pelox
JOROX_METRICS_HOST=metrics.jorox.qorvelworks.internal
JOROX_SEAL=seal_c78f63c1
JOROX_STANDBY_TEAM=norax